Spend Sunday mornings in Bridgeport, where The Duck Inn is ready and waiting with s'mores French toast, rotisserie duck hash, buttermilk biscuits and a seemingly endless supply of Bloody Mary mix. If you prefer savory to sweet and whiskey to bubbles, Longman & Eagle is the Holy Grail of Chicago's brunch offerings. A family-run, BYOB Puerto Rican staple in Humboldt Parks Paseo Boricua, this bright, naturally-lit restaurant serves Chicago creations likeajibarito breakfast sandwicha fried plantain sandwich with eggs, ham, lettuce, tomato, and garlic served with a side of coconut oatmeal. Just like everything else on offer here, Farm Bars brunch menu features seasonal, locally-sourced ingredients including fruit and honey from owner TJ Callahans Brown Dog Farm in Wisconsin. Chef-owner Carlos Gaytn offers a mix of sweet and savory entres like Belgian waffles served with duck leg carnitas, sweet potato puree, and poached egg, and orange-scented French toast served withpink peppercorn ice cream and berries. Among old-school leather seats and steaming griddles, youll find both American and Filipino dishes, including tocino with eggs and spam and egg sandwiches.
